What the OP describes as a bug is the fact that if a player receives a summon in an instance, from another player, who is also in that instance, then hearthstones out of the instance before the summoning timer has expired, he is unable to accept the summon.

What you are referencing is the patch in which Blizzard made it possible for players to summon other players, who are not in their instance, directly into it.

That's not what he claimed. After 2.4, you could summon player into an instance if the player was outside but met the instance requirements, ok. This was definitely not possible during Vanilla, and it's not possible on Nostalrius.
The question raised above is wether the following was possible or not : I'm in an instance an I summon a player that is already in the instance (same instanced zone, summoning works) BUT the summoned players Hearthstones to repair or whatever and then accepts the TP to be back in the instance.

The logic would tend to say that the TP popup should disappear if you change of instanced area, or just display an error message if you accept a TP porting you to somewhere located in a different instance, but someone above said it was actually possible during Vanilla.
